Global weather stations average temperature
We visualized weather stations around the world in a 3D environment.
We wanted to see how varied data generated in a space can be turned into a living organic entity that gives actionable feedback to the user in order to further explore the developing field of sensor technology. This resulted in a visualization that didn't simply communicate numbers or information, but rather gives the user a 'feeling' of whether or not the measured data is good.
The challenge was to show atmospheric data as a 3D entity, therefore we learned how to use the 'Three.js' JavaScript 3D library in combination with 'shaders'.
Smart home technologies will empower people in managing a healthy atmosphere in spaces that they live. This experiment exemplifies a strong approach by displaying data as 'living and breathing' to create a more organic relationship with data.
